Abstract :
TerraSAR-X is an X-band synthetic aperture radar satellite which is financed, designed, built and operated in frame of a public-private partnership between the German Aerospace Center DLR and Astrium GmbH. The TerraSAR Frontend is based on the DLR funded technology program DESA [R. Zahn et al., June 2002]. End of 2005, TerraSAR X will be launched into a circular, sun-synchronous 514 km dusk-dawn orbit. The use of an active phased array antenna allows for a wide variety of advanced SAR modes like ScanSAR or SpotlightSAR. This supports the commercial use of the radar for earth observation services and also offers through its flexibility a good experimental platform for radar scientists. The design drivers for the array are not only antenna performance but mainly the thermal stability, mass and power efficiency and cost effectiveness.
